Output e59800f71da2a2e73b348900f6a1dea151565e07ed53b0c6aedfab55c8131538:20

value
208000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d30315b08e3e6e6813fe9c2e40b350e20dd61866 OP_EQUAL
address
3LvkCMH95x3DGXYj5s757ZaBaqDV89Htgs
transaction
e59800f71da2a2e73b348900f6a1dea151565e07ed53b0c6aedfab55c8131538
spent
true